Designer: Katsukawa Shunshō & Kitao Shigemasa Era: Taisho | Currency: $ / £ / € Price: ![]() Description: This is a Taisho-era reproduction of a book originally published in 1786, titled 'Ehon Takaranoito: Kaiko Yashinahisou (picture book of treasure threads: silkworm cultivation)'. It's a Japanese-bound book with 12 woodblock prints designed by Katsugawa Harusho and Kitao Shigemasa, depicting the process of silkworm breeding and silk production. Nice design on the cover using cocoon as a pattern, beautifully made woodblock prints inside. This book has stains/spots mostly on the front cover, back cover, and pastedowns but the inner pages are in good condition.
